My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Lexi is a 4 month old female Doberman puppy we took in after seeing pictures of her on craigslist being sold with very bowed front legs. Her owner surrendered her after talking with her. She has Hypertropic Osteodystrophy which occurs in the front legs of Large Breed puppies who grow too fast due to poor nutrition. She has seen a specialist and Lexi is defiantly doing great and recovering nicely. Both legs are nice and straight now. She can now just enjoy being a puppy, she is fed a large breed puppy food to help her bones grow at the right pace. Lexi is house and crate trained and is good with dogs, kids and cats. She knows sit, down, stay and some other commands as her foster mom works with her daily. She is also good on the leash. She is fostered in Belton, Texas.
